Allen Christiansen, who's been the acting manager at Tankersley Enterprises since Bob's illness, has taken over the business. We just concluded a seat purchase from him and the seats we got were in excellent shape at a very fair price. They were better than described.
Over the last 25 years we've purchased used seats, concession equipment, lenses, rewinds, projector heads, splicers, etc. from Tankersley and our satisfaction level approaches 100%. We'll continue to use Tankersley as long as we continue to get the equipment and service we need.

Steve Tankersley is now running the company. They were not at the Rocky Mountain convention this year -- first time they've missed it to my knowledge -- but there was a good reason: Bob Tankersley passed away last Sunday night. Here is a short obit I found on the net:
Robert K. Tankersley We are deeply saddened but also comforted to announce the passing of Robert K. (Bob) Tankersley of Tankersley Enterprises, Denver, Colorado. He suffered from Leukemia and passed on Sunday, August 12th, 2007. Bob was well known throughout the motion picture industry, being the founder of Theatre Equipment Association (now ICTA) and SHOWTEST, as well as former President of Rocky Mountain Picture Assn. and other local associations. Bob's passions included driving his race cars, skiing, and the theatre business. Bob was also honored by the Who's Who Society. Bob is survived by his wife Susan; four children, Rod, Sandi, Steve, and Tony; several grandchildren and great grandchildren.
